✅ 7-Day Kenai Peninsula Itinerary — Highlights

Day 1 — Arrive & Explore Soldotna
Walk the Kenai River Boardwalk, spot bald eagles, and enjoy local dining.

Day 2 — Bear Viewing Adventure
Floatplane tour to Lake Clark or Katmai National Park — Alaska’s most iconic wildlife experience.

Day 3 — Kenai National Wildlife Refuge
Hiking, canoeing, or scenic drives through 2 million acres of wilderness.

Day 4 — Road Trip to Homer
Visit the Homer Spit, galleries, sea views, coastal cafes, and beach walks.

Day 5 — Glacier Cruise in Seward
Explore Kenai Fjords National Park — whales, sea otters, tidewater glaciers.

Day 6 — Local Culture & River Recreation
Biking trails, visitor centers, shopping, or a relaxing Kenai River float.

Day 7 — Relaxing Departure
Slow morning at the lodge, sunrise photos, optional souvenir stops.
